Aya turned one year on 20th November!

No major problems so far. Just had to change the front passenger seat heater for free in March.

Interesting how her mood changes depending on manual or automatic gearbox mode.
Automatic is a lot smoother, but sometimes it switches gears when I don't need it.
Manual is more jerky, gears are switching faster. And engine braking is more pronounced.

Although the car is driven daily, I only did 5554 km after a year. xD

Also, interesting that the engine compartment still looks really clean after a year.
